A group in Carson is working to revitalize a cemetery that closed last month after its owner became severely ill: 'This is restoring community at its best and I cheer them.'

Now, residents whose family members are buried in the cemetery are leading a large community cleanup effort.

"We want it to be a beautiful park so that when you come to visit your loved ones, you're at a nice beautiful park that would make you feel good. Right now, it is in really bad shape," she said. Carson Mayor Pro-Tem Jawane Hilton said he helped get the cemetery's water back on in time for the cleanup.

Volunteers like Carl Kemp and his 11-year-old daughter Maya stopped by to remember and honor those resting at the cemetery, from cleaning gravestones to mowing the weeds away.
